Problems solved by technology

However, in recent years, the preparation of ultrafine and nano soft ferrite powder has become a hot spot, such as ultrafine and nano soft ferrite powder using high energy ball milling method, sol-gel method, hydrothermal method, chemical co-precipitation method and other indicators , which has the advantages of fine powder particle size, uniform distribution, large surface area, and high activity, but ultrafine and nano soft ferrite powders also have the disadvantages of poor fluidity, poor formability, low bulk density, and poor compressibility, which are not conducive to the next step. Compression process, so must be granulated

Abstract

The invention provides a granulation method for ultrafine and nano soft magnetic ferrite powder. According to the method, rolling equipment, a crushing machine, turntable stirring and rolling equipment and a vibration sieve group are adopted. The method comprises the steps of putting the ultrafine and nano soft magnetic ferrite powder into a powder storage bin for rolling, crushing the powder through the crushing machine, putting the powder into the turntable stirring and rolling equipment for granulation through a material inlet, putting granulated particles into a material receiving hopper, and putting the particles into the vibration sieve group for screening through a material outlet. The soft magnetic ferrite particles obtained by the granulation method provided by the invention can be used for a subsequent pressing technology for soft magnetic ferrite magnet production; the whole process is executed in a closed and continuous manner; the granulation method has the characteristics of reasonable design, simple equipment, easiness in control, suitability for industrial production and the like.

Description

Techn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the field of powder metallurgy, and particularly relates to a method for granulating ultrafine and nano soft ferrite powder. Background technique [0002] Soft ferrite is based on Fe 2 O 3 The main components of ferrimagnetic oxides include Mn-Zn, Cu-Zn, Ni-Zn and other series, among which Mn-Zn ferrite has the largest output and consumption. Soft ferrite has the advantages of high saturation magnetic flux density, high permeability, low medium and high frequency loss, low cost, etc., and is widely used in many fields such as household appliances, network communications, automotive electronics, aerospace and military industry. [0003] The production process of soft ferrite adopts powder metallurgy, that is, through mixing, granulating, pressing, sintering and other processes.
